About The Role

This position is listed on behalf of a partner company, who manages all applications and next steps. Our partner is looking for an Implementation Specialist based in Canada.

This is an exciting opportunity to join a growing technology environment focused on delivering software solutions to golf course operators.The Implementation Specialist will guide clients through the full software implementation journey, from post-sale discovery through configuration, training, and <launch.You> will act as a trusted partner to customers, translating their operational needs into effective system setups and tailored solutions.The role combines project coordination, client communication, software configuration, training, and <problem-solving.You> will manage multiple projects, milestones, deliverables, and client expectations while ensuring implementations remain on track.Success in this position requires strong knowledge of golf course operations, technical confidence, and a highly organized, action-oriented approach.This is a hands-on role offering the opportunity to make a direct impact on customer adoption and implementation success.

Accountabilities

  • Schedule and lead post-sale client meetings, gathering the information, data, requirements, and feedback needed to configure software solutions effectively.
  • Create and manage detailed implementation project plans, tracking tasks, milestones, deliverables, timelines, and client approvals.
  • Serve as a primary point of contact throughout the implementation process, maintaining clear and proactive communication with customers.
  • Configure software systems according to each client's operational requirements, using knowledge of golf course management processes and business needs.
  • Train customers on the software platform and relevant add-on modules, adapting training to their specific workflows and requirements.
  • Document all client-specific configurations and customizations in dedicated implementation documentation.
  • Manage project deliverables and identify potential risks or delays to keep implementations progressing efficiently.
  • Prepare cost and timeline estimates for additional development or professional services requested by clients and support the associated billing process.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to resolve implementation challenges and ensure a smooth transition from sales through deployment and customer adoption.
  • Perform additional duties and contribute to continuous improvements in implementation processes as required.
